ATLANTIS FOUND!
SPAIN – A U.S-led research team has located the lost city of Atlantis, in mud flats in southern Spain.
The World's Only Reliable News
SPAIN – A U.S-led research team has located the lost city of Atlantis, in mud flats in southern Spain.